描述(由申请人提供):骨科植入物相关感染不仅对医疗保健系统来说是昂贵的,而且影响着全世界的患者。这些感染的主要原因是存在于已形成的自然生物膜中的细菌,这些细菌在创伤时或随后的手术中污染开放性骨折部位。为了直接和局部地对抗和预防这些感染,人们研究了种植体的抗生素表面涂层。然而,由于微生物对抗生素的耐药性不断发展,缺乏从种植体表面长期洗脱的特性,并且在许多情况下,对革兰氏阴性和革兰氏阳性细菌的活性谱有限,抗生素仍然具有显着的局限性。因此,需要开发用于骨科植入物的新型抗菌涂层。在此,我们建议研究一种新型抗菌药物-阳离子类固醇抗菌剂-13 (CSA-13),它对革兰氏阴性和革兰氏阳性细菌具有优异的广谱活性。我们打算使用CSA-13作为骨科固定板的表面涂层,以防止感染。在我们的实验设计中,为了促进强烈的感染信号,我们将建立金黄色葡萄球菌的生物膜生长在CDC生物膜反应器系统上,后者提供了一种创建标准化生物膜的手段。优惠券将插入固定板底部的凹槽中,作为一个整体,固定板/优惠券将直接放置在羊的胫骨表面上。两组变量的求值;csa -13涂层或未涂层、生物膜处理或未处理的种植体将决定这种新型抗菌涂层是否具有对抗和可能预防骨科、生物膜种植体相关感染的潜力。此外,研究的第二阶段将使用氚作为CSA-13的放射性标记物,以确定CSA-13对组织的局部和全身影响。通过闪烁计数和组织学分析,确定CSA-13对组织和骨折愈合的影响。综上所述,本实验旨在首先分析新型CSA-13抗菌药物在已建立的生物膜中对抗和预防由常见的骨科病原体金黄色葡萄球菌引起的骨科植入物相关感染的能力,其次确定CSA-13是否对宿主组织和终末器官有有害影响。我们希望通过这些手段,提高平民和军队创伤患者的骨科创伤护理水平。

DESCRIPTION (provided by applicant): Orthopaedic implant-related infections are not only costly to healthcare systems, but affect patients the world over. Contributing significantly to these infections are bacteria residing in established biofilms of nature that contaminate open fracture sites either at the time of trauma or during subsequent surgery. In an attempt to fight and prevent these infections, directly and locally, antibiotic surface coatings of implants have been investigated. However, antibiotics continue to have significant limitations due to evolving antibiotic resistance by microorganisms, a lack of long-term elution properties from implant surfaces and, in many instances, a limited spectrum of activity against Gram-negative and Gram-positive bacteria. Thus, novel antimicrobial coatings need to be developed for orthopaedic implants. Herein, we propose to investigate a novel antimicrobial - cationic steroid antimicrobial-13 (CSA-13) - which has superior broad-spectrum activity against Gram-negative and Gram-positive bacteria. We intend to use CSA-13 as a surface coating on orthopaedic fixation plates to prevent infection. To promote a strong infection signal in our experimental design, established biofilms of Staphylococcus aureus will be grown on coupons from the CDC biofilm reactor system, the latter provides a means to create standardized biofilms. The coupons will be inserted into a notch in the fixation plate on its underside and as a unit, the fixation plate/coupon will be placed directly onto the surface of the tibia of sheep. The evaluation of two sets of variables; CSA-13-coated or uncoated and biofilm-treated or untreated implants will determine if this novel antimicrobial coatings has the potential to fight and possibly prevent orthopaedic, biofilm implant-related infections. Furthermore, a second phase of the study will use tritium as a radiolabel on CSA-13 to determine the local and systemic effects of CSA-13 on tissue. By scintillation counting and histological analysis, the effects of CSA-13 on tissue and fracture healing will be determined. Taken together, the proposed experiments are designed to analyze first, the ability of the novel CSA-13 antimicrobial to fight and prevent orthopaedic implant-related infection promoted by a common orthopaedic pathogen, S. aureus, in an established biofilm and second, to determine if CSA-13 has detrimental effects on host tissue and end organs. We hope, by these means, to improve the orthopaedic trauma care of both civilian and military trauma patients.
